Tax-rate lookup cache (Fernwick service). Cache warms on boot from the rates table; TTL is 15 minutes. If stale rates are reported, flush via the Fernwick CLI and confirm the invalidation counter increments. Do not bypass the cache in production — direct reads are unaudited. Rotation of the read-only credential happens quarterly under the Oakhollow policy. The cache loader connects using the string below.

replica DSN, yahaf-yagaf: mongodb://tamath_svc:a2netSk3RZMuTj@db-d084.novacsoft.internal:5432/ralmir

Finance Review Summary — Sales Leads

Next year's headcount plan for Quillbrook Trading allocates 22 new roles, of which nine sit within commercial functions. Salary budget rises 7.5%, absorbing both market adjustments and the new Ashfold territory team. Ramp assumptions give new hires six months to full quota; forecasts have been adjusted accordingly. Attrition is modelled at 11%, consistent with recent experience. Approval gates apply quarterly. The plan's connection to broader commercial strategy appears in the confidential note below.

management briefing: The pricing group signed off on a budget of $378.8 million for Project Kasael.

Attendees: Priya Venn (chair), Carl Osway, Mira Tull, branch leads. Priya walked through the plan to shift Bramblewick customers from monthly to annual billing starting Q3. Upside: smoother cash flow, fewer failed payments. Concerns raised: churn risk in the Fennport branches and support load during the switchover. Agreed: 10% annual discount, 90-day grandfathering for existing accounts, branch comms pack by end of month. Carl to draft FAQ. For context, the rationale ties into plans summarised below.

confidential, kagup-bafog: Fraaxax Group is in early talks to buy Soroxox Group for about $343.8 million. The Olidor launch date is June 14, and nothing goes to the press before then. Legal wants the Aldmirek Logistics term sheet signed before July 23.

Finance Review — Harwick Division Hiring Freeze. Freeze effective since April; 14 open roles withdrawn. Quarterly payroll savings: 610k. Attrition risk flagged in engineering; two backfills approved by exception. Opex tracking 4% under plan. Recommend holding the freeze through year-end pending the Calver acquisition outcome. The confidential planning note is appended below.

internal memo for yahag-tahog: The pricing group signed off on a budget of $152.8 million for Project Soriel.